Output 91e63fd7ffa33ba39bda7ebc7d235e018752743d714071ea719c10853f0d0c7f:1

value
2670437
script pubkey
OP_0 OP_PUSHBYTES_20 6d03e75db65e372be605348b2f181ee63327c5bc
address
bc1qd5p7whdktcmjhes9xj9j7xq7ucej03durfrwym
transaction
91e63fd7ffa33ba39bda7ebc7d235e018752743d714071ea719c10853f0d0c7f
spent
true